

On January 31, 2018 Yukiko passed away peacefully at the North Shore Hospice. Survived by her son Les (Phyllis), daughter Ivy (Ray), grandson Alexander, sister Sachie (Mits), and many nieces and nephews. Predeceased by her parents Keiichi and Kiku (Matsuda) Ikeda, husband Roy, sister Hisako, and brothers Harry and Tom. Yukiko was born February 26, 1923 in Burquitlam, B.C. and was raised in Otsumi, Yamaguchi-ken, Japan. She returned to the family farm in Haney, B.C. when she was 15 years old. After the war years, in the Tashme Internment Camp, the Ikeda family moved to Winnipeg MB where she married her lifelong partner Roy, raised 2 children, and contributed widely to the community. Her world revolved around her home and there were many family gatherings with memorable food, laughter, and card games. She worked as an industrial seamstress where her skill ensured a secure home life. The last 18 years were spent in North Vancouver living with her son, daughter- in-law, and favourite grandson Alexander. The family is grateful for the exceptional care Yukiko received at Lions Gate Hospital and the North Shore Hospice. In lieu of flowers or Okoden, please consider a donation to the Lions Gate Hospital Foundation (North Shore Hospice) or the Vancouver Buddhist Temple. Yukiko worked tirelessly all her life, gave fully of her time to others, and can now, deservedly, rest in peace.
